Collaborative Effort for a Greener Tomorrow

The beating heart of Delilah I is its dynamic partnerships. WEC Energy Group stands as the primary owner, while automotive titans Honda and Tesla have eagerly signed on to drive this solar marvel forward. Their commitment is not just a business transaction; it’s a bold pledge to the planet. Honda, securing 200 MW, and Tesla, taking 100 MW, are purchasing this energy through virtual power purchase agreements (VPPAs), ensuring that the clean energy generated flows seamlessly into the local grid.

This collaboration exemplifies Honda and Tesla’s unwavering commitment to slashing emissions and enhancing energy diversity across the nation. For Honda, this solar endeavor marks a significant milestone on their journey toward a carbon-neutral future. Their efforts will slice through CO2 emissions from U.S. auto manufacturing operations, propelling them closer to sourcing all their electricity needs from carbon-free sources.

Key Facts About the Delilah I Solar Energy Center

Capacity and Scale: The Delilah I Solar Energy Center boasts a massive capacity of 300 MW, illustrating its potential to significantly alter the regional energy landscape. This positions it among the largest solar power projects in the state.

Major Players: The collaboration among WEC Energy Group, Honda, and Tesla highlights a strategic alliance aimed at reducing carbon footprints. Both Honda and Tesla have entered into Virtual Power Purchase Agreements (VPPAs), showcasing a financial and ethical commitment to sustainable energy.

Innovative Energy Solutions: The use of VPPAs by Honda and Tesla allows these corporations to secure energy competitively while supporting the integration of renewables into the local grid. This mechanism not only stabilizes energy costs but also supports more predictable energy sourcing.
